Capacitance and Inductance Measurements
NOTE: An external AC power source is required to make
capacitance and inductance measurements.
1.
Set up the MODEL V-20 and the external power source as shown in figure 2.
WARNING:
Make certain the external power source is off before connecting the capacitance or inductance to be measured.
2. For capacitance readings of .009 MF to 1MF or for inductance readings, set the DC-AC-OUTPUT switch to AC
and the RANGE switch to 10V, and (with the meter leads connected across the secondary of the power transformer)
adjust the external power source for a full-scale reading of 10 volts rms. For capacitance readings of .0001 MF to. 03
MF, set the RANGE switch to 250V, and adjust the external power source for a full-scale reading of 250 volts rms.
CAUTION: Adjust the external power source starting from its lowest voltage so as not to overload the meter on the
selected scale.
3. With the capacitance or inductance in series with the secondary of the power transformer, as shown in figure
2,
read the voltage on the meter; then refer to table 1 (capacitance of .009 MF to IMF), table 2 (capacitance of. 0001 MF
to .03 MF), or table 3 (inductance of 5H to 1000H) to ob/n t-the corresponding value of capacitance or inductance.
